Stihl has recalled roughly 100,000 chainsaws because the fuel link can leak, posing fire and burn hazards.

This recall involves Stihl MS 461 gas-powered chainsaws, and the MS 461 R chainsaw with a wrap handle. The model number is on the model plate, located on the starter cover. The chainsaws are gray and orange with “STIHL” on the engine cover. Recalled chainsaws have a serial number between 173092800 and 181993952, under the front hand guard on the engine housing’s sprocket side. 

Stihl has received 117 reports of pinched or leaking fuel lines. No fires, property damage or injuries have been reported.

The chainsaws were sold at authorized Stihl dealers nationwide from July 2012 through December 2016 for about $1,000.

The chainsaws were manufactured in Germany.
